Are you an Aussie planning a trip to Europe? First things first, make sure your copyright is up to snuff. You'll need a valid Australian copyright with at least six months of validity remaining beyond your intended departure date from the Schengen Area.
It's also necessary to check the specific entry requirements for each European state you plan to travel to, as these can vary. Some countries may require additional documents like a visa or evidence of accommodation and travel coverage.
